The initial stage of the spinodal decomposition in a TiO//2. SnO//2(1:1) compound has been examined using 1 MV high-resolution transmission electron microscopy (HRTEM). Crystal structure images reveal that the compositional fluctuation in the left bracket 001 right bracket direction occurs with a wavelength of about 70A. Since the darkness of the sites, which correspond to each row of metal atoms aligning along left bracket 010 right bracket , is related to the mixing ratio between Ti and Sn, the local compositional variation in each exsolved region is known directly from the image contrast.
